Chicken Thigh Fat Type. Chicken thighs contain roughly 3 times more fat than chicken breasts, however, relative to other cuts of animal protein both are considered lean protein sources. A rotisserie chicken thigh without the skin contains 7.5 grams of fat. Next up is the drumstick, followed by breast meat, which is the leanest cut of chicken. Take a look at the actual numbers and the total fat count in a chicken thigh compared to a breast: There are 1.95 grams of saturated fat, 3.3 grams of monounsaturated fat, and 1.1 grams of polyunsaturated fat.
